Page 1 of 3 1 2 3 LastLast
Results 1 to 15 of 37

Thread: 25 jaar Delphi (1995 - 2020)

  1. #1
    John Kuiper
    Join Date
    Apr 2007
    Location
    Almere
    Posts
    8,645

    25 jaar Delphi (1995 - 2020)

    Delphi entered the world on February 14th, 1995 as the best Windows 3.11 development tool (16-bits). Today, not only is it still the best solution for developing Windows applications in 32 and 64-bits, but it also supports macOS, Android, iOS, and Linux.

    Ik vraag mij nog steeds af hoeveel bedrijven (en particulieren) gebruik maken van Delphi buiten de VCL om.
    Ik was verbaast dat Albelli alleen VCL gebruikt en voor andere platforms een andere ontwikkel tool.
    Delphi is great. Lazarus is more powerfull

  2. #2
    Fornicatorus Formicidae VideoRipper's Avatar
    Join Date
    Mar 2005
    Location
    Vicus Saltus Orientalem
    Posts
    5,470
    Bedoel je: "Hoeveel bedrijven (en particulieren) gebruiken Delphi voor niet-VCL (Windows) ontwikkeling?"

    Ik moet eerlijk zeggen dat ik nog geen enkel bedrijf ben tegengekomen dat geheel of gedeeltelijk (FMX) Delphi gebruikt voor MacOS, iOS, Android of Linux-toepassingen, maar mijn wereldje is best beperkt, dus ik weet niet hoe de echte cijfers liggen. Ook op fora/discussiegroepen (als NLDelphi) zie ik niet-VCL-vragen maar weinig voorbij komen, maar misschien ligt het aan mij.
    TMemoryLeak.Create(Nil);

  3. #3
    mov rax,marcov; push rax marcov's Avatar
    Join Date
    Apr 2004
    Location
    Ehv, Nl
    Posts
    10,141
    Wel, ik ben bedrijven tegengekomen (sterker nog, er gewerkt) die met Delphi COM en Server applicaties maakten. Maar goed dat is niet (echt) VCL, maar al helemaal niet FMX.

    Die COM business waren activeX applets in MSIE, dat is nu waarschijnlijk ook niet echt springlevend meer :-)

    In feite waren die COM applets de client, en de server was gewoon een Webhub server (tservice gebaseerd).

  4. #4
    John Kuiper
    Join Date
    Apr 2007
    Location
    Almere
    Posts
    8,645
    Waar zit nu daadwerkelijk de kracht van Delphi na 25 jaar?

    Volgens Embarcadero in het gebruik van verschillende ontwikkeltools zoals FMX en IoT. Ik ben werkelijk (maar mijn wereld is ook klein) nog niet tegengekomen.
    Delphi is great. Lazarus is more powerfull

  5. #5
    mov rax,marcov; push rax marcov's Avatar
    Join Date
    Apr 2004
    Location
    Ehv, Nl
    Posts
    10,141
    Dat is meer waar ze hopen dat er daar potentiele groei is. Ze weten dat de bestaande gebruikers een stel ouwe z*kken zijn.

    In de praktijk mondt het echter uit bulletlijstjes vullen om nog een jaar subscriptions te rechtvaardigen. En toen dat niet werkte, werden subscriptions verplicht :-)

  6. #6
    Ik gebruik delphi al lange tijd, maar heb een keer geprobeerd om FMX te gebruiken, voor windows leverde dat geen enkel verbetering op, ios kan ik niet compilen omdat ik geen apple heb, linux gebruik ik liever lazarus voor of schrijf het in python. En voor android gebruik ik liever android studio zelf - tis even oefenen, maar werkt 10x beter en sneller als je t gewoon bent. VCL vind ik persoonlijk heel sterk, maar die FMX integratie heb ik nooit echt begrepen.. Vroeger wel nog met Kylix gewerkt (D6).

  7. #7
    Ik was verbaast dat Albelli alleen VCL gebruikt en voor andere platforms een andere ontwikkel tool.
    Ik niet. Die producten waren er al voordat fmx er was of delphi multiplatform werd. Je gaat een codebase van honderdduizenden regels in een draaiend bedrijf niet even omgooien omdat er een nieuwe tool beschikbaar komt. Ook de luxe om vanaf 0 opnieuw te beginnen is er maar voor weinigen.

    ErikB heeft zijn nieuwe versie van zijn programma wel gebouwd in fmx. Dat zag er gewoon strak uit.

    Ik weet dat er in duitsland een aantal mensen enthousiast mee bezig zijn en ook in America. In de facebook delphi group zie je ook dat er best veel mensen mee bezig zijn, ook nieuwe aanwas (nieuwe delphi gebruikers..)

    In nl kom ik fmx nog weinig tegen. Hier is het vooral maintenance op oude code (vaak d2007) met een buts componenten. Vaak gebruiken die ook de devex troep en die zijn nu eenmaal vcl only. Wel ben ik de afgelopen jaren meerdere bedrijven tegengekomen die hun legacy zijn gaan migreren naar de huidige versies van delphi, vaak met groeiende teams.

    Als je een delphi job zoekt zijn er nu volop kansen.

  8. #8
    Registered User
    Join Date
    Mar 2004
    Location
    Apeldoorn
    Posts
    9
    Hier een duitstalig artikel over het 25-jarige jubilem van Delphi:
    https://www.heise.de/hintergrund/25-...t-4660219.html

  9. #9
    Senior Member ErikB's Avatar
    Join Date
    Aug 2010
    Location
    Biddinghuizen
    Posts
    438
    Klopt wat Benno zegt.
    Ik ben er mee begonnen in het XE2 tijdperk. Het was vallen en opstaan. Inmiddels heb ik vrijwel alles onder controle onder Rio.
    FMX is leuk / fijn werken, al is het alleen maar om bijvoorbeeld de TScaledLayout component.
    Ik gebruik naast de standaard componenten nu FastReport voor de overzichten en veel TMS , inclusief de nieuwe sets zoals RemoteDB.
    De applicatie is inmiddels gegroeid: een compile geeft zo'n 850.000 regels aan.

    en o ja .... ik gebruik livebindings ( ja dat werkt echt )
    Erik

  10. #10
    mov rax,marcov; push rax marcov's Avatar
    Join Date
    Apr 2004
    Location
    Ehv, Nl
    Posts
    10,141
    Quote Originally Posted by Benno View Post
    Ik niet. Die producten waren er al voordat fmx er was of delphi multiplatform werd. Je gaat een codebase van honderdduizenden regels in een draaiend bedrijf niet even omgooien omdat er een nieuwe tool beschikbaar komt. Ook de luxe om vanaf 0 opnieuw te beginnen is er maar voor weinigen.
    En belangrijker, doe je dat ALS je het kan dan weer in Delphi?

  11. #11
    John Kuiper
    Join Date
    Apr 2007
    Location
    Almere
    Posts
    8,645
    Quote Originally Posted by Dataforger View Post
    Hier een duitstalig artikel over het 25-jarige jubilem van Delphi:
    https://www.heise.de/hintergrund/25-...t-4660219.html
    Leuk artikel. Maar zegt weinig over het gebruik van de huidige releases.
    Delphi is great. Lazarus is more powerfull

  12. #12
    En belangrijker, doe je dat ALS je het kan dan weer in Delphi?
    Waarom niet?

    Wat zou jij gebruiken nu voor een applicatie bestemd voor windows en eventueel Mac Marco?

  13. #13
    mov rax,marcov; push rax marcov's Avatar
    Join Date
    Apr 2004
    Location
    Ehv, Nl
    Posts
    10,141
    Quote Originally Posted by Benno View Post
    Waarom niet?

    Wat zou jij gebruiken nu voor een applicatie bestemd voor windows en eventueel Mac Marco?
    Visual Studio, en de "eventuele platformen" droppen. Of twee client code bases met de engine in C++ dll/.so

  14. #14
    en je gui dan Marco?

  15. #15
    mov rax,marcov; push rax marcov's Avatar
    Join Date
    Apr 2004
    Location
    Ehv, Nl
    Posts
    10,141
    In de vendor geprefereerde taal. Swift, Java (Android) of C#/WPF, whatever.

    Maar om nu vanuit niks aan FM te beginnen met als motivatie van shared source alleen? Nee. Dat zie ik niet zitten. Zowel technisch als commercieel lijkt me dat niet verantwoord.

    Na de VCL is Delphi waarschijnlijk dood voor mij. Met pijn in het hart, want ik ben toch voor alles een Pascal man.
    Last edited by marcov; 17-Feb-20 at 21:29.

Page 1 of 3 1 2 3 LastLast

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•